2011 Arizona recruiting class set

Feb 3, 2011, 3:20 AM | Updated: 4:29 am

The University of Arizona signed 17 players to National Letters of intent Wednesday, including two home town stars from around Tucson.

The 2011 class includes Rivals.com three star rated offensive lineman Jacob Arzouman from Salpointe Catholic High School, who is expected to play at guard or center for the Wildcats and four star running back Ka’deem Carey from Canyon del Oro High School.

Carey committed to the U of A last summer but flirted with becoming a Sun Devil until signing with the Wildcats Wednesday.

The class included 11 offensive players, nine defensive players and two kickers, including prep players and junior college transfers.

Three of the recruits were from Arizona while the others are products of Texas, Hawaii, Oklahoma, Louisiana and American Samoa.

The U of A also landed three star recruit and Oklahoma native Domonique Petties, who was also considering Arkansas, Missouri, Oklahoma, Oklahoma State, Pittsburgh, Texas A&M, Texas Tech and Tulsa.

“We’re pleased with the overall class and the job our staff did in evaluation and keeping on top of the entire process,” Stoops said.

“We filled immediate needs and got players on both sides of the ball and for the kicking game.”
